American astrophysicists have raised a question, if the Earth's orbit has been able to catch interstellar visitors, this does not mean that they are orbiting the earth, it refers to the orbit that the earth runs around the sun, which is an ellipse of about 930 million kilometers and that our planet takes 365 days and almost 6 hours to travel.


The point is that in that orbit where the earth has settled quietly for billions of years, it is possible that some interstellar object may have also settled, because we already know that in that area there are some asteroids that must be watched, since they they may be a potential impact risk to our planet, but it is possible that some of them did not come from the solar system, that some of them came from beyond another star.

The study that is in the news now applied numerical simulations, analyzed the efficiency of Jupiter in capturing interstellar objects and compared that efficiency with that of the earth-moon system in order to capture them, the authors obtained something that seems obvious Jupiter is 10,000 times more efficient in capturing objects that it comes beyond the solar system and its gravity would place them in the region where the centaurs are.


Which is what a type of asteroid located between Jupiter and Saturn with fairly unstable orbits is called, Jupiter beats us in this but the interstellar objects captured by Jupiter turn out to be more unstable, scientists have calculated that on average they end in only 150,000 years being expelled from the solar system and back down among the stars, however, those captured by the earth-moon system have a half-life of about 130,000 years.


The study revealed that with current technology, at least one or two of these objects captured in near-Earth orbit could be detected, with a minimum size of between 50 and 70 meters, this does not mean that there is one that is larger. conclusion if we want to study an interstellar object we would not need to go out and chase a new one that reaches the solar system we can search among the asteroids close to our planet because perhaps a visitor from a distant star has been among them for a long time.
